Best time to go to Burrawang

The best time to visit Burrawang is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. January is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January67.5°F (19.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
February65.3°F (18.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March62.2°F (16.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
April56.8°F (13.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
May50.5°F (10.3°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yAverageAverage
June46.4°F (8.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July45.3°F (7.4°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
August46.8°F (8.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
September51.8°F (11.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October56.3°F (13.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age
November60.6°F (15.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
December64.0°F (17.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ly High

What is the best area to stay in Burrawang?
The best area to stay in Burrawang is within the village center itself, particularly around the main intersection of Hoddle Street and Illawarra Highway.This compact village is known for its rural charm and historic buildings. The Burrawang General Store and the Burrawang Hotel, both well-known local landmarks, are situated right at this central point. The layout is easy to navigate, with most amenities and points of interest concentrated within a short walking distance.Couples looking for a peaceful retreat will find the village center appealing. It provides a quiet setting with opportunities for leisurely strolls through the countryside, enjoying the views of rolling hills and farmland. The local hotel often features a warm fireplace, making it a cozy spot to relax in the evenings.Travelers seeking a relaxed pace and a taste of rural Australian life will appreciate staying directly in Burrawang.
When is the best time to go to Burrawang?
The best time to visit Burrawang is typically during the autumn months of March, April, and May, or the spring months of September, October, and November.These periods offer pleasant weather, avoiding the hotter summer temperatures and the cooler, wetter winter. The countryside surrounding Burrawang is particularly scenic during autumn with changing foliage, and in spring, when wildflowers bloom. This makes it an ideal time for couples or solo travelers who enjoy outdoor activities like scenic drives, gentle walks, and exploring the local agricultural landscape.For those interested in local events, visiting during autumn can coincide with the Burrawang Easter Market, a popular event showcasing local produce and crafts.
